£37,000 - £42,000 + Bonus (OTE 44k) + 10% Pension + 36 Days Holiday + Training + Progression
Barnstaple, Devon
Are you a Mechanic/Vehicle Technician looking for a career where you are invested in, with full internal training to become a qualified HGV Technician? In this hands-on role you will be dealing with light goods vehicles such as vans and cars that have been planned in for maintenance or servicing, then completing the required jobs on the vehicles. You will gain further training on HGVs once fully up to speed.
Founded in the early 90's, this contract hire and fleet management company work closely with local authorities across the country and pride themselves on their extremely stable growth and commitment to sustainability. This role will be working out of a new workshop which they have gained through their continuous expansion.
This role would suit someone with experience working on cars or vans, looking to gain further training and progress directly to an HGV Technician.
The Role:
- Hands-on maintenance, repairs, and servicing of light goods vehicles
- Training and progression onto HGVs
- Workshop based, with very occasional on site call outs
- Monday - Friday, days-based, 45 hours a week
The Person:
- Vehicle Mechanic / Technician
- Looking to progress onto HGVs
